parser

Написать ответ на текущее сообщение

 

 
   команды управления поиском

Ответ

Mizter Egoist 09.04.2017 16:29 / 09.04.2017 17:27

Сделал приблизительное форматирование, получается вот так:
{"bID":{"name":"bID","value":"B79DAC9F-2AAD-46F7-A9D4-EC29E7B9E57C","create":"2017-04-09 14:53:44"},"cID":{"name":"cID","value":"41A9846D-8CCD-4297-BA7D-10372C5ED55A","create":"2017-04-09 14:53:44"},"sID":{"name":"sID","value":"guest","create":"2017-04-09 14:53:44"}}
Если это разбить в редакторе вручную:
{
  "bID":{
    "name":"bID",
    "value":"B79DAC9F-2AAD-46F7-A9D4-EC29E7B9E57C",
    "create":"2017-04-09 14:53:44"
  },
  "cID":{
    "name":"cID",
    "value":"41A9846D-8CCD-4297-BA7D-10372C5ED55A",
    "create":"2017-04-09 14:53:44"
  },
  "sID":{
    "name":"sID",
    "value":"guest",
    "create":"2017-04-09 14:53:44"
  }
}
Лучше не стало, все равно ошибка.
Самое интересное в том, что когда просто вставляю строку в $json_string, то все хорошо, а при получении $form:storage ничего не работает.
$json_string[$form:storage]
$h[^json:parse[$json_string]]
^h.foreach[key;value]{
  $key=$value
}[<br>]
/bulk/ajax/auth.html(23:14): 'parse' empty string is not valid json [json.parse] [uri=/bulk/ajax/auth.html, method=POST, cl=0]
/bulk/ajax/auth.html(23:14): 'parse' illegal quote escape, json may be tainted at line 1 {\"bID\":{\"name\":\"bID\",\"value\":\"B79DAC9F-2AAD-46F7-A9 ^ [json.parse] [uri=/bulk/ajax/auth.html, method=POST, cl=427]